> On 27.12.2013 19:25, Andrey Borzenkov wrote:
> > В Чт, 26/12/2013 в 23:54 +0400, Andrey Borzenkov пишет:
> >> I'm not sure how to fix it. It is pulled in by build-grub-pep2elf and
> >> build-grub-pe2elf. Those are build time programs and so use
> >> BUILD_CPPFLAGS; adding CPPFLAGS_GNULIB is probably not appropriate. It
> >> compiles just fine with error.h commented out. May be something like
> >>
> >> #if !defined(GRUB_BUILD) || defined(HAVE_ERROR_H)
> >>
> > 
> > On the second glance - why is <error.h> needed at all? Nothing defined
> > there is used in misc.c and on Linux it compiles just fine with error.h
> > as well.
> > 
> > May be we could simply drop it?
> > 
> Yes. I was going to answer with this. Many of includes are inherited by
> copying of include parts.
> error.h there can simply be removed

done
